What Are Dental Implants?

A dental implant is a titanium root and is used as a replacement tooth root. It is inserted in the jawbone, where it gets fixed in the bone after a while. After healing, a crown is cemented on the implant to serve as an entire tooth and natural-colored tooth.

Benefits of Dental Implants

Selecting dental implants from our dentist near you has numerous benefits, such as:

  • Natural Aesthetic: The implants are fashioned to resemble your natural teeth.
  • Increased Comfort: Implants provide a sense of security and stability, as compared to removable dentures.
  • Healthy Smile: Implants preserve the health of your jawbone and prevent you from losing bone.
  • Long-Lasting: If cared for, implants can last for decades.
  • Better Chewing: Implants work like your own teeth so that you can chew all of your favorite foods.

The Dental Implant Process

  1. Consultation: Our dentist in Coquitlam will evaluate your oral condition and develop a treatment plan for you.
  2. Implant Placement: This titanium post is subsequently placed surgically into your jawbone.
  3. Healing Period: Your implant will heal over a period of several months as it becomes integrated with the bone.
  4. Abutment and Crown: Following healing, an abutment and a personal crown will be attached to complete your new tooth.

How long does the dental implant process take?
From start to finish, the process usually takes three to six months. This includes placing the implant, waiting for bone healing, and fitting the final crown for a perfect bite.
